Road Course Information / Classes

*Enthusiast* Street Tire Class:
DOT 140+ treadwear
N/A Class
Forced Induction Class
*Enthusiast* Race Tire Class:
any R-comp tire
N/A Class
Forced Induction Class
any mods allowed but must use a DOT 140+ treadwear street tire
N/A Class
Forced Induction Class
Unlimited Street Tire Class:
any mods allowed but must use a DOT 140+ treadwear street tire
N/A Class
Forced Induction Class
Unlimited Race Tire Class:
any mods with race tires
N/A Class
Forced Induction Class
*Enthusiast Class*: The Enthusiast Class has modification limitations and is intended for relatively “stock” vehicles. Upgrades allowed are:
Intake system (pre-turbo/supercharger, or pre-Throttle body for N/A)
Exhaust system (Turbo back, No limits for N/A)
Engine tune or piggyback computer.
Suspension mods allowed: springs and/or shocks and front/rear sway bars.
(8+ cylinder powered cars will be put into the forced induction class)
